The InterContinental Century City: Helicopter Tours of Los Angeles and More
Guests who check in to the swanky InterContinental Century City find the hotel to be nothing short of impressive. Oozing Hollywood glamour, the InterContinental has sophisticated facilities and gorgeous guest rooms. From your private balcony, you can see across Los Angeles to the Pacific Ocean. The Westside address is an unbeatable location- within walking distance of Beverly Hills’ Rodeo Drive, 20th Century Fox Studios, and MGM Tower, and within driving distance of the Getty Center, LA city center, and the beach. In fact, there’s a complimentary town car to take you shopping or wherever you want in LA! And the concierge team, famous for organizing “In the Know” Insider experiences offered at InterContinental hotels worldwide, can take care of just about any request. A helicopter tour of the City of Angels is an unforgettable experience. (From the InterContinental’s helipad above the 17th floor you can take in views of the Hollywood Hills, Santa Monica, and the Pacific). The concierge will gladly arrange helicopter rides in the morning, afternoon or sunset, for you to appreciate the sprawling, beautiful city from the air.
